在信息技术飞速发展的今天,代码已成为我们生活的重要组成部分。从智能穿戴设备到互联网平台,从无人驾驶汽车到人工智能助手,代码无处不在。而在这庞大的代码海洋中,上亿行的代码无疑是一颗璀璨的星辰,它见证了人类智慧的辉煌,也展现了技术发展的无限可能。
一、上亿行代码背后的智慧
1. 严谨的逻辑思维
代码是逻辑思维的最佳体现,上亿行代码背后,是程序员们严谨的逻辑思维。他们通过编写代码,将抽象的问题转化为具体的操作,让计算机能够理解和执行。在这个过程中,程序员们需要具备强大的逻辑思维能力,才能编写出高效、稳定的代码。
2. 持续的学习与创新
上亿行代码的积累,离不开程序员们持续的学习与创新。在技术快速发展的背景下,程序员们需要不断学习新技术、新方法,以提高代码质量。他们还需要勇于创新,探索新的编程思路,为软件开发注入新的活力。
3. 协作与沟通能力
上亿行代码的编写,往往需要多个程序员共同完成。在这个过程中,良好的协作与沟通能力至关重要。程序员们需要相互理解、支持,共同面对挑战,才能确保项目顺利进行。
二、上亿行代码面临的挑战
1. 维护难度大
随着代码行数的增加,维护难度也随之加大。一方面,大量代码可能导致系统性能下降;另一方面,新增功能或修复bug时,容易引发新的问题。因此,如何有效维护上亿行代码,成为软件开发的一大挑战。
2. 质量控制难度高
上亿行代码的质量控制难度较高。一方面,代码审查、测试等工作需要耗费大量人力;另一方面,随着代码量的增加,代码之间的耦合度也会不断提高,使得代码质量难以保证。
3. 人才培养与储备
上亿行代码的编写,需要大量优秀的程序员。当前我国程序员人才储备不足,导致软件开发进度受到影响。如何培养和储备优秀人才,成为上亿行代码面临的一大挑战。
三、上亿行代码的发展前景
1. 技术不断革新
随着人工智能、大数据等新技术的快速发展,上亿行代码将得到进一步的优化和升级。新技术将为程序员们提供更多编程工具,提高代码质量,降低开发成本。
2. 编程语言多样化
未来,编程语言将更加多样化。针对不同领域、不同需求,将涌现出更多高效、易用的编程语言。这将有助于上亿行代码的编写和优化。
3. 跨界融合
上亿行代码将在各个领域得到广泛应用。未来,代码将与其他技术跨界融合,如物联网、云计算等,为人类生活带来更多便利。
上亿行代码是人类智慧的结晶,它见证了我国软件产业的蓬勃发展。面对挑战,我们要不断学习、创新,提高代码质量,为我国软件产业注入新的活力。相信在不久的将来,我国将涌现出更多优秀程序员,共同谱写上亿行代码的辉煌篇章。